1 Reply Latest reply: Mar 21, 2006 1:14 PM by 807573 RSS

    Upgrade problems with ldap Admin Console authentication

    807573
      Hi, I upgrade one ldap server with patches and now I cannot logging with admin user, I installed this patches:

      114677-11 115342-02 115610-23 115614-26 116837-02 119211-07

      some of them are for admin console, but now I see the logs in the console admin:

      [21/Mar/2006:10:24:56] info (21206): successful server startup
      [21/Mar/2006:10:24:56] info (21206): SunONE-WebServer-Enterprise/6.0SP3 B05/19/2004 02:48
      [21/Mar/2006:10:24:56] info (21206): Access Host filter is: *.int
      [21/Mar/2006:10:24:56] info (21206): Access Address filter is: *
      [21/Mar/2006:10:24:56] info (21208): Installing a new configuration
      [21/Mar/2006:10:24:56] info (21208): [LS ls1] http://ldap.int, port 390 ready to accept requests
      [21/Mar/2006:10:24:56] info (21208): A new configuration was successfully installed
      [21/Mar/2006:10:24:57] info (21208): Using the Java HotSpot(TM) Client VM v1.4.2_04 from Sun Microsystems Inc.
      [21/Mar/2006:10:24:57] info (21208): Java VM classpath: /ldap/mps/serverroot/bin/https/jar/NSServletLayer.jar:/ldap/mps/serverroot/bin/https/jar/NSJavaUtil.jar:/ldap/mps/serverroot/bin/https/jar/NSJavaMiscUtil.jar:/ldap/mps/serverroot/bin/https/jar/servlet.jar:/ldap/mps/serverroot/bin/https/jar/servlet-2.3-filters-api.jar:/ldap/mps/serverroot/bin/https/jar/jspengine.jar:/ldap/mps/serverroot/java/ldapjdk.jar:/ldap/mps/serverroot/java/jss311.jar:
      [21/Mar/2006:10:24:57] info (21208): Loading IWSSessionManager by default.
      [21/Mar/2006:10:24:57] info (21208): IWSSessionManager: Maximum number of sessions is 1000
      [21/Mar/2006:10:25:16] failure (21208): for host ::ffff:163.194.50.35 trying to GET /admin-serv/authenticate, cgi-parse-output reports: the CGI program /ldap/mps/serverroot/bin/admin/admin/bin/userauth did not produce a valid header (program terminated without a valid CGI header. Check for core dump or other abnormal termination)
      [21/Mar/2006:10:25:47] failure (21208): for host ::ffff:163.194.50.35 trying to GET /admin-serv/authenticate, cgi-parse-output reports: the CGI program /ldap/mps/serverroot/bin/admin/admin/bin/userauth did not produce a valid header (program terminated without a valid CGI header. Check for core dump or other abnormal termination)
      [21/Mar/2006:10:31:10] info (21208): Exiting JVM

      looks like something in the autentication process, I try with diferent user with admin rights and its the same, looks like something in the process authentication.
      In the ldap normal service only shows normal logs with no errors.

      If somebody know about this please help, I still searching the problems.

      Thanks.
        • 1. Re: Upgrade problems with ldap Admin Console authentication
          807573
          problem resolved!

          the solution was adding ldap library paths to the kernel:

          [root@ldapeast east]# crle -v -l /usr/lib -l /ldap/mps/serverroot/lib
          output configuration file: /var/ld/ld.config
          adding default library path (ELF): /usr/lib
          adding default library path (ELF): /ldap/mps/serverroot/lib
          [root@ldapeast east]# crle

          Configuration file [version 4]: /var/ld/ld.config
          Default Library Path (ELF): /usr/lib:/ldap/mps/serverroot/lib
          Trusted Directories (ELF): /usr/lib/secure (system default)

          Command line:
          crle -c /var/ld/ld.config -l /usr/lib:/ldap/mps/serverroot/lib

          [root@ldapeast east]# crle -v -u -l /usr/local/lib -l /usr/krb5/lib
          output configuration file: /var/ld/ld.config
          adding default library path (ELF): /usr/local/lib
          adding default library path (ELF): /usr/krb5/lib
          [root@ldapeast east]# crle

          Configuration file [version 4]: /var/ld/ld.config
          Default Library Path (ELF): /usr/lib:/ldap/mps/serverroot/lib:/usr/local/lib:/usr/krb5/lib
          Trusted Directories (ELF): /usr/lib/secure (system default)

          Command line:
          crle -c /var/ld/ld.config -l /usr/lib:/ldap/mps/serverroot/lib:/usr/local/lib:/usr/krb5/lib